About University
The University of the West of England, Bristol (UWE Bristol) is a public research university, located in and around Bristol, England, which received university status in 1992.[2] In common with the University of Bristol and University of Bath, it can trace its origins to the Merchant Venturers' Technical College, founded as a school in 1595 by the Society of Merchant Venturers.[3][4]
UWE Bristol is made up of several campuses in Greater Bristol. Frenchay Campus is the largest campus in terms of student numbers, as most of its courses are based there. City campus provides courses in the creative and cultural industries, and is made up of Bower Ashton Studios, Arnolfini, Spike Island, and Watershed. The institution is affiliated with the Bristol Old Vic Theatre School and validates its higher education courses. Frenchay Campus and Glenside Campus are home to most of the Faculty of Health and Applied Sciences, with a further Adult Nursing cohort based at Gloucester Campus. Hartpury Campus provides training in animal sciences, sport, equine, agriculture and conservation. In 2018, the Teaching Excellence Framework awarded the university Gold.[

University of the West of England (UWE Bristol) is a dynamic public university located in Bristol, England, celebrated for its practical, industry-focused education. Established in 1992, it has grown into one of the UK's largest universities, attracting over 30,000 students with its emphasis on employability and real-world skills. UWE Bristol stands out for blending academic rigor with hands-on learning, making it a top choice for career-oriented programs.
Popular Academic Areas
UWE Bristol excels in several fields, earning national recognition for its innovative teaching and research. Here's what it's most famous for:
- Engineering and Built Environment: Renowned for aerospace engineering and architecture, with strong ties to Bristol's aviation industry. Programs feature cutting-edge facilities like flight simulators and sustainable design labs.
- Business and Law: Highly regarded for entrepreneurship and management courses, boasting a 96% graduate employment rate. The Bristol Business School offers real business simulations and global partnerships.
- Health and Social Care: A leader in nursing, physiotherapy, and biomedical sciences, with clinical placements in top NHS hospitals. It's popular for addressing modern healthcare challenges like mental health and public health.
- Creative Industries: Famous for animation, film, and journalism, supported by Bristol's vibrant media scene. Students collaborate on projects with BBC and Aardman Animations.
